Public Relations Specialist

Work from home Full-time role Hiring

Penn State University is seeking a Public Relations Specialist to join its Office of Strategic Communications. The successful candidate will influence and develop communications for a vast University community, support editorial oversight for newsletters and news content, and assist with various communications strategies and initiatives.

Responsibilities

  • Support the editorial oversight and production of the Penn State Today electronic newsletter, which is sent to students, faculty, and staff across all Penn State campus locations and to external subscribers
  • Serve as an important editorial voice for the Penn State News website, the University’s official news source
  • Build relationships with communications professionals in units across the University and work closely with them to drive key communications initiatives at the campus, college, and unit levels
  • Assist with editing news stories submitted by communications professionals from across Penn State
  • Play a key role in monthly monitoring and reporting on overall performance of Strategic Communications’ owned news communications platforms
  • Support and advance a multi-channel approach to community-building storytelling efforts, such as student success and employee recognition
  • Support University-wide goals and priorities by drafting and executing comprehensive communications strategies and plans, in partnership with internal communications team leaders
  • Draft institution-wide administrative announcements, such as appointments, departures, and awards
  • Collaborate with colleagues within Strategic Communications and across the University to build strategies that drive maximum engagement with internal and external audiences and amplify positive content
  • Enhance multimedia storytelling on official Penn State platforms to support and advance the broader strategic goals of Strategic Communications and the University

Skills

  • Bachelor's Degree
  • 1+ years of relevant experience; or an equivalent combination of education and experience accepted
  • Possess excellent news judgment and exacting attention to detail as an editor
  • Have a thorough knowledge of AP editorial style
  • Possess a clear writing style and an ability to translate complex concepts into accessible communications
  • Be adept at managing relationships with a diverse array of stakeholders, including providing constructive feedback and suggestions to content authors
  • Be able to draft high-profile, University-wide communications, anticipating audience questions and considering potential perceptions of the University community and the public
  • Have a working understanding of an SEO-forward writing style
  • Be highly organized and able to manage multiple priorities with varying deadlines
  • Work well both independently and as part of multiple cross-functional, fast paced teams
  • Possess a solid work ethic, sound judgment, and strong problem-solving skills
  • Proactively seek opportunities for professional development, learning opportunities, and mentorship
  • Have experience using Microsoft Office and Adobe Photoshop
